Numerous factors like dust and mites trigger allergies in dogs. And yes, the food is also one of them. And then there are molds, pests, meds, smoke, grasses, and pollen. But when it comes to the allergies caused by foods, you can prevent them by feeding the right food.

 

In order to understand dog food allergies, you need to know how they happen. These happen when the pet’s immune system overreacts to certain ingredients. And produce antibodies against some parts of the food like protein or carbohydrates. Such allergies generally happen after continuous and long exposure to certain forms or types of food. What Are Signs Symptoms Of Food Allergies In Dogs

Some signs of food allergies are itchy skin, paws, and ears. Digestive upsets like diarrhea and vomiting can also indicate food allergies. Other symptoms can be weight loss, lack of energy, sluggishness, and also hyperactivity. 

 

But before jumping to any conclusion, consult your veterinarian. Your vet may prescribe tests to diagnose food and environmental allergies. He may suggest diet changes for your dog. Vets generally use a hypoallergenic trial diet for a few weeks. This helps in pinning down the causes of food allergies. Not all adverse reactions to food are allergies. Real food allergies are those that happen as a result of an immune response to certain food. Whereas food sensitivities are not related to any immune response. But to gradual reaction to certain foods that are offending your dogs. Food sensitivities also result in dermatologic signs like poor coat and skin. And also GI signs like vomiting, and chronic infections in the foot or ear. 

How To Treat Food Allergies In Dogs

Once the ingredient causing the allergy is identified, it is easier for you. While there are no accurate medications, it is best to avoid these ingredients in pet food. There are different kinds of hypoallergenic diets.

1. Veterinary Hydrolyzed Protein Diet - This formulated food comes with broken-down protein molecules. The purpose is to make these molecules unrecognized by your dog’s system.

2. Veterinary Novel Protein Diet - This diet avoids the use of any products that your dog is used to eating. This food is also known as a limited ingredient diet. The food avoids any source of protein that causes an immune response.

You can also prepare a novel protein diet at home as suggested by a pet nutritionist or vet. This food can be enhanced by adding supplements. Further, let's see some great veterinary foods you can buy from pet supplies stores
